The Wild Soccer Bunch 5 (2008)
Beyond the Horizon
"The Wild Soccer Bunch" celebrate their last victory against the "Silver Lights" - and set one record in volley-pass game after another in the forest. But they are not alone: Vampires target the team. To lure them into their bunker, they kidnap Leon. Will Vanessa ever see him again?
Director: Joachim Masannek
Genre: Family, Adventure, Comedy
Runtime: 107 min
Release Date: February 20, 2008
